Truro to Bodmin - 6 July

Another very hilly stage. When I was cycling slower than walking pace I got off and walked. Only 26 miles in a direct line but 44 if you go by Newquay and Padstow (lovely crab sandwich on the quay) as I did.

My friend 'J' made me a lovely breakfast. I had put her up for a few weeks with her previous viesler just over a decade ago.
